Overlooking the Power of Tax-Advantaged Accounts

 

It's surprising exactly how often high earners neglect the full power of tax-advantaged accounts past the traditional 401(k). Health And Wellness Savings Accounts (HSAs), as an example, deal three-way tax benefits-- contributions are tax-deductible, growth is tax-free, and withdrawals for qualified costs are likewise tax-free. HSAs are not just for clinical expenditures; they can serve as a stealth retirement account when used tactically.

 

Likewise, backdoor Roth IRAs are underutilized devices for high-income income earners who eliminate of typical Roth payments. With mindful control, this strategy allows for significant long-term, tax-free growth. Leveraging these devices calls for insight and a clear understanding of IRS policies, however the reward can be amazing in time.

 

The Importance of Managing Investment Income

 

High-earners typically produce substantial investment income, yet not all financial investment earnings is exhausted equally. Certified returns and long-term capital gains appreciate reduced tax prices, while rate of interest income and short-term gains can activate much greater tax obligations. Without a plan in position, individuals can unintentionally press themselves into greater tax braces or activate unpleasant shocks like the Net Investment Income Tax (NIIT).

 

Tax-loss harvesting, possession location approaches, and calculated rebalancing are techniques that can lessen these concerns. Missing the Charitable Giving Advantages

 

Philanthropic giving is commonly seen via a purely selfless lens, yet it's also an effective tax obligation planning tool when done attentively. Instead of just composing checks, high-earners can make use of approaches like giving away appreciated securities or establishing donor-advised funds (DAFs). These methods not just magnify the philanthropic effect yet likewise give improved tax benefits.

 

Contributing valued assets, as an example, permits the donor to avoid paying capital gains taxes while still declaring a charitable deduction. It's a win-win, yet lots of upscale people leave these advantages untapped as a result of absence of recognition or poor timing.

Estate Planning: The Silent Tax Saver

 

While estate preparation is often associated with riches transfer after death, its tax benefits throughout life are typically overlooked. Yearly gifting, leveraging life time exemptions, and establishing irreversible trusts are all methods that can decrease both estate and revenue taxes.

 

A robust estate strategy not only makes sure that assets are handed down successfully but can additionally lead to substantial tax cost savings today. Waiting till later in life to think about estate preparation misses out on the chance to carry out approaches that require time to develop and supply optimal advantages.
